Mel C says the Spice Girls weren’t subjected to sexual harassment in the music industry, because men were terrified of them.
But sexist attitudes they faced from record labels lit a “fire in their bellies” to promote Girl Power. “I get asked quite a lot about the #MeToo movement within the music industry and if I ever experienced anything,” says Mel. “And I’m like are you kidding me?
No one would come near the Spice Girls because they were petrified of us. “You knew if you messed with one of them you’d have to deal with the other four...
